Nigeria Centre for Disease Control-NCDC has recorded one hundred and twenty six new infections in the country.

It made this known on its official twitter handle.

According to the Public Health Agency, Nigeria now has fifty six thousand, six hundred and four confirmed cases of COVID-NINETEEN.

The Centre explained that it had completed the deployment of SORMAS across seven hundred and seventy four Local Government Areas and Federal Capital Territory.

SORMAS is a digital surveillance tool which facilitates reporting of cases of epidemic prone diseases including COVID-NINETEEN by health workers across the country.
